Blownrat, any and every poweradder has the same "deadly" affects on a stock engine. If you ran a blower on your van that added only 50 horse it wouldn't do any more or less damage than the 50 shot of nitrous. I'm supercharged as well and prefer it to N20, but don't knock the guys using it. It takes as much skill to perfectly tune a nitrous vehicle as it does a force inducted one. Horsepower being equal ( ie: 250 shot o' juice or boost needed to equal that), a turbo or centrifugal blower puts LESS strain on an engine than nitrous. Your roots blower, however, is probably just as "harmful" as nitrous. |
